The Big Players: Established Social Media Platforms

1. Facebook

Despite increasing competition, Facebook continues to dominate the social media landscape, with over 2.8 billion monthly active users as of 2021.

To maintain its position, the platform has introduced new features, such as Facebook Shops for businesses, and enhanced its focus on privacy and security.

With the continued growth of Facebook Groups, users can easily connect with like-minded individuals, making the platform an essential tool for personal and professional networking.

2. Instagram

Owned by Facebook, Instagram has solidified its position as the go-to platform for visual content, boasting over 1 billion monthly active users. Instagram’s recent updates, including Reels and Shopping, have expanded the platform’s capabilities, making it an attractive choice for creators, influencers, and businesses looking to showcase their products and services.

Additionally, the Instagram algorithm now favors content that drives genuine engagement, encouraging users to create more authentic and interactive posts.

3. Twitter

Twitter remains the preferred platform for real-time news and updates, with its 330 million monthly active users relying on the platform for breaking news, opinions, and entertainment.

Twitter has expanded its offerings with Spaces, an audio-based feature that allows users to engage in live conversations, broadening the platform’s appeal beyond traditional text-based content.

The integration of Revue, a newsletter service, also enables creators to monetize their content more effectively.

4. LinkedIn

As the leading professional networking platform, LinkedIn is indispensable for job seekers, professionals, and businesses alike.

With over 774 million members, the platform has invested in enhancing its job search and skill development tools, such as LinkedIn Learning, to provide users with valuable resources for career advancement.

In addition, the introduction of Creator Mode allows users to showcase their expertise and grow their personal brand.

5. YouTube

YouTube continues to dominate the video content market with over 2 billion logged-in monthly active users.

In response to the growing popularity of short-form content, YouTube launched Shorts, a feature allowing creators to share short, engaging videos.

The platform also continues to innovate with features like YouTube Premium, YouTube TV, and live streaming, offering users a diverse range of content and entertainment options.

Rising Stars: Emerging Social Media Platforms

6. TikTok

TikTok has taken the world by storm with its addictive short-form video content, amassing over 1 billion monthly active users since its launch in 2016.

As a global phenomenon, TikTok has influenced trends in music, fashion, and lifestyle, making it a powerful platform for creators and businesses looking to capitalize on viral moments.

With the introduction of TikTok For Business, the platform has become increasingly attractive to advertisers and brands.

7. Clubhouse

Clubhouse, the audio-based social media platform, allows users to join virtual rooms and engage in real-time conversations on various topics.

Since its launch in 2020, Clubhouse has expanded its offerings, introducing features like Clubhouse Creator First and the ability to monetize rooms through ticket sales.

These enhancements have attracted a diverse range of influencers, experts, and thought leaders, making Clubhouse a must-try platform for users seeking intellectual and professional engagement.

8. Discord

Originally designed for gamers, Discord has evolved into a versatile platform for community-building and communication.

With over 150 million monthly active users, Discord now serves a wide range of interest groups, from hobbyists to businesses.

The platform’s focus on privacy, real-time chat capabilities, and customizable servers have contributed to its growing popularity among users seeking an alternative to traditional social media platforms.

9. Caffeine

Caffeine is a live streaming platform that emphasizes real-time interaction and collaboration.

With a user-friendly interface and unique features like real-time chat, Caffeine offers a more engaging and interactive experience compared to other live streaming platforms.

Its partnership with celebrities, influencers, and gaming communities has attracted a diverse range of users, making it a noteworthy contender in the live streaming market.

10. Vero

Vero’s ad-free social experience and commitment to user privacy and control set it apart from other platforms.

With a subscription-based business model, Vero allows users to enjoy an ad-free environment while maintaining control over their data.

The platform’s focus on high-quality content and meaningful connections has gained traction among users who value a more genuine social media experience.

Niche Platforms: Specialized Social Media Sites

11. Goodreads

Goodreads is a social platform dedicated to book lovers, offering a space for readers to discover new books, share recommendations, and engage with authors.

With over 90 million members, Goodreads provides a comprehensive database of books, allowing users to rate, review, and create personalized reading lists.

The platform also hosts events like author Q&As and book giveaways, fostering a strong sense of community among its users.

12. Untappd

Untappd is a social network designed for beer enthusiasts, allowing users to discover, rate, and share their favorite brews and breweries.

With a database of over 10 million beers, Untappd offers personalized recommendations based on user preferences, making it easier to find the perfect brew.

The platform also hosts events and facilitates connections with fellow beer lovers, creating a unique and engaging social experience.

13. Strava

Strava combines fitness tracking with social networking, providing athletes and fitness enthusiasts a platform to log their workouts, track their progress, and connect with like-minded individuals.

With features like challenges, clubs, and segments, Strava encourages friendly competition and community-building among its users.

The platform also offers premium features like advanced analytics and training plans through its subscription-based Strava Summit program.

14. Letterboxd

Letterboxd is a social platform tailored for film enthusiasts, providing a space for users to rate, review, and create personalized lists of movies.

With a database of over 700,000 films, Letterboxd enables users to discover new movies, engage in discussions, and follow their favorite critics and filmmakers.

The platform’s sleek interface and strong community make it an essential tool for any film buff.
